5 Scatter Plot: A graph of ordered pairs that represent 2 different sets of data. i.e. You could plot how many hours you worked at a job for a week and the paycheck amount you received for the hours you worked. You could see if there was a relationship between your 2 sets of data.

6 Positive Correlation: When your data graphs in a POSITIVE slope.

7 Negative Correlation: When your data graphs in a NEGATIVE slope.

8 No Correlation: When there appears to be no significantly positive nor negative slope forming. (your data is unrelated to each other)
